Women were more concerned about the issue than men, though the latter were more likely to cite substance abuse as one of the biggest health problems.52 New Zealand has a greater number of psychiatrists and mental health professionals relative to its population than many high-income countries, but access to care is uneven across the country.53 In 2021, 85 percent of psychiatrists reported that people needing specialist treatment were often unable to access the right care due to resource constraints, while 13 percent said they were sometimes unable to do so
